What to check before for buildings with rent-stabilized apartments in the Bronx

  • Expect regulated rent prices to help keep housing costs manageable.
  • Verify the specific rent stabilization conditions for each building, as they can vary.
  • Check for any additional fees or terms before signing a lease, including maintenance fees or policies on renewals.
  • Review building amenities and conditions through tenant feedback available on Openigloo.
  • Confirm the building’s compliance with rent stabilization regulations for ongoing protections.
